summ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Matthias Schwarzott <zzam@gentoo.org>2007-04-02 10:48:19 +0000
committerMatthias Schwarzott <zzam@gentoo.org>2007-04-02 10:48:19 +0000
commit7df14ef4b22f68053aba3afdb0821966af269152 (patch)
treeea1460541b3d9db46507140fa3dc488c050f3885 /media-plugins/vdr-osdteletext
parentUpdated blockers (diff)
downloadhistorical-7df14ef4b22f68053aba3afdb0821966af269152.tar.gz
historical-7df14ef4b22f68053aba3afdb0821966af269152.tar.bz2
historical-7df14ef4b22f68053aba3afdb0821966af269152.zip
Added vdr-1.5 patch.
Package-Manager: portage-2.1.2.3
Diffstat (limited to 'media-plugins/vdr-osdteletext')
-rw-r--r--media-plugins/vdr-osdteletext/ChangeLog11
-rw-r--r--media-plugins/vdr-osdteletext/Manifest28
-rw-r--r--media-plugins/vdr-osdteletext/files/digest-vdr-osdteletext-0.5.1-r13
-rw-r--r--media-plugins/vdr-osdteletext/files/vdr-osdteletext-0.5.1-vdr-1.5.patch55
-rw-r--r--media-plugins/vdr-osdteletext/vdr-osdteletext-0.5.1-r1.ebuild29
5 files changed, 115 insertions, 11 deletions
diff --git a/media-plugins/vdr-osdteletext/ChangeLog b/media-plugins/vdr-osdteletext/ChangeLog
index 3a99da2e87e2..5f096cb50a5f 100644
--- a/media-plugins/vdr-osdteletext/ChangeLog
+++ b/media-plugins/vdr-osdteletext/ChangeLog
@@ -1,6 +1,13 @@
# ChangeLog for media-plugins/vdr-osdteletext
-# Copyright 1999-2006 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-plugins/vdr-osdteletext/ChangeLog,v 1.7 2006/09/28 11:27:38 hd_brummy Exp $
+#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/media-plugins/vdr-osdteletext/ChangeLog,v 1.8 2007/04/02 10:48:19 zzam Exp $
+
+*vdr-osdteletext-0.5.1-r1 (02 Apr 2007)
+
+ 02 Apr 2007; Matthias Schwarzott <zzam@gentoo.org>
+ +files/vdr-osdteletext-0.5.1-vdr-1.5.patch,
+ +vdr-osdteletext-0.5.1-r1.ebuild:
+ Added vdr-1.5 patch.
28 Sep 2006; Joerg Bornkessel <hd_brummy@gentoo.org> files/rc-addon.sh:
correct PATH handling
diff --git a/media-plugins/vdr-osdteletext/Manifest b/media-plugins/vdr-osdteletext/Manifest
index 3e90565b6f96..b093090dfe11 100644
--- a/media-plugins/vdr-osdteletext/Manifest
+++ b/media-plugins/vdr-osdteletext/Manifest
@@ -13,15 +13,23 @@ AUX rc-addon.sh 1118 RMD160 891f99d1cf023958057fbe2ab822b2f59173ee65 SHA1 adb93e
MD5 0450c4b6d9048c9d2ede560720fb7543 files/rc-addon.sh 1118
RMD160 891f99d1cf023958057fbe2ab822b2f59173ee65 files/rc-addon.sh 1118
SHA256 224a99a4006e12a653e36d9c90f9c69dc215111c8d795ff76b69d331add02042 files/rc-addon.sh 1118
+AUX vdr-osdteletext-0.5.1-vdr-1.5.patch 1646 RMD160 f87e53a04d1c660d2fae0d5cac9bc528e505f3a2 SHA1 0d4efeae2dafa1b8ca54e3d45b7340c92a1ea7b5 SHA256 88fcb36684c2c2c9b4c2cb5ddc912af17278b06e1595a3f30ac52bacf61eae7d
+MD5 99599c0ee67525196a286b6ad47effec files/vdr-osdteletext-0.5.1-vdr-1.5.patch 1646
+RMD160 f87e53a04d1c660d2fae0d5cac9bc528e505f3a2 files/vdr-osdteletext-0.5.1-vdr-1.5.patch 1646
+SHA256 88fcb36684c2c2c9b4c2cb5ddc912af17278b06e1595a3f30ac52bacf61eae7d files/vdr-osdteletext-0.5.1-vdr-1.5.patch 1646
DIST vdr-osdteletext-0.5.1.tgz 58631 RMD160 b53bee592844f4527917fe28a322e3561de19092 SHA1 acb2723c4208e083a34d3e23cfae1513615b63f7 SHA256 e3cb0b95d351d0fc63ba3e1ca82f776e44f1a1945ffad574b54a55e0169fa969
+EBUILD vdr-osdteletext-0.5.1-r1.ebuild 853 RMD160 94120ec77018b25582384fe82533f1c59b4c4ec9 SHA1 f4a2c5a82143273fd9a7847c13a3726c9cc63845 SHA256 f657c197b82a2cb0350c3814347eec0a05143662901d454cfa986008ea8103cd
+MD5 f8246e9364dcac919472e9f6e1bff525 vdr-osdteletext-0.5.1-r1.ebuild 853
+RMD160 94120ec77018b25582384fe82533f1c59b4c4ec9 vdr-osdteletext-0.5.1-r1.ebuild 853
+SHA256 f657c197b82a2cb0350c3814347eec0a05143662901d454cfa986008ea8103cd vdr-osdteletext-0.5.1-r1.ebuild 853
EBUILD vdr-osdteletext-0.5.1.ebuild 816 RMD160 ce2cd0cd617dcac7736425731b10d3684eba74be SHA1 e610a273173f9404ae60a91ae242f97407c5b13d SHA256 9284ddf37e0dab13eb175fe1674a1bce5b7738680bc8959b8a9f4950542995fe
MD5 1b7c4e375459794e534f6747c98fc982 vdr-osdteletext-0.5.1.ebuild 816
RMD160 ce2cd0cd617dcac7736425731b10d3684eba74be vdr-osdteletext-0.5.1.ebuild 816
SHA256 9284ddf37e0dab13eb175fe1674a1bce5b7738680bc8959b8a9f4950542995fe vdr-osdteletext-0.5.1.ebuild 816
-MISC ChangeLog 1062 RMD160 13c9a632f3e013ce60207b6d2368509d5bd60fca SHA1 9c918aa395abc5f11e0c60dae4ea326dfbf7ff03 SHA256 25e426eff15371eb49d16633d5b1cb1429b450ad39c1924999375a4c6da3cff4
-MD5 d0efb8e39a099a06fd2e6d8177333508 ChangeLog 1062
-RMD160 13c9a632f3e013ce60207b6d2368509d5bd60fca ChangeLog 1062
-SHA256 25e426eff15371eb49d16633d5b1cb1429b450ad39c1924999375a4c6da3cff4 ChangeLog 1062
+MISC ChangeLog 1257 RMD160 8eb6f4d9efe72ca7d8277e4a2f78b6f7ef700af7 SHA1 b213f2983da844c0913317c65363bf2ff3d011b9 SHA256 99c2f56992d878d2f8a570244648e9fd46f039ce9ba51d054c460d4cc4b734f7
+MD5 4b6d7c99ebe1688ab6e6c26c59a0035c ChangeLog 1257
+RMD160 8eb6f4d9efe72ca7d8277e4a2f78b6f7ef700af7 ChangeLog 1257
+SHA256 99c2f56992d878d2f8a570244648e9fd46f039ce9ba51d054c460d4cc4b734f7 ChangeLog 1257
MISC metadata.xml 428 RMD160 3be78f0eb360511ef05eb47d87aa3e59ef2484af SHA1 3321e1f1de113a21ae5e707d086f5dfda96467eb SHA256 7c0b6e088887e638b4fc4107b92dc81775cd3b8c9a55b16a05c2025de3e68150
MD5 eb608a4a5e947db8ef2a8bdb8bd22402 metadata.xml 428
RMD160 3be78f0eb360511ef05eb47d87aa3e59ef2484af metadata.xml 428
@@ -29,11 +37,13 @@ SHA256 7c0b6e088887e638b4fc4107b92dc81775cd3b8c9a55b16a05c2025de3e68150 metadata
MD5 9bcd6b295ffd97f60a92f9303b564a27 files/digest-vdr-osdteletext-0.5.1 253
RMD160 3a0ccfa90925e1d66b5923dd20c0a05e45ecc53f files/digest-vdr-osdteletext-0.5.1 253
SHA256 8ea6924cc92874c0f31d4399d28a20be6b5f56ebc8183d8eb4903eb208fde43a files/digest-vdr-osdteletext-0.5.1 253
+MD5 9bcd6b295ffd97f60a92f9303b564a27 files/digest-vdr-osdteletext-0.5.1-r1 253
+RMD160 3a0ccfa90925e1d66b5923dd20c0a05e45ecc53f files/digest-vdr-osdteletext-0.5.1-r1 253
+SHA256 8ea6924cc92874c0f31d4399d28a20be6b5f56ebc8183d8eb4903eb208fde43a files/digest-vdr-osdteletext-0.5.1-r1 253
-----BEGIN PGP SIGNATURE-----
-Version: GnuPG v1.4.5 (GNU/Linux)
-Comment: no further Information
+Version: GnuPG v2.0.3 (GNU/Linux)
-iD8DBQFFG7Hkdn07HTTCgIoRAkFjAJ0QMl4ff/qpIpZJ8DWDqoIrNC24RACfVAWJ
-2vC8yc/O+dX+Y15AMncvTnw=
-=k13V
+iD8DBQFGEN9/t2vP6XvVdOcRAmk3AKDQgPTppAzeF3TashpJKGr4IP3HVQCgvP26
+QXLan3MZElri/hQjPOkl4cc=
+=8Bzn
-----END PGP SIGNATURE-----
diff --git a/media-plugins/vdr-osdteletext/files/digest-vdr-osdteletext-0.5.1-r1 b/media-plugins/vdr-osdteletext/files/digest-vdr-osdteletext-0.5.1-r1
new file mode 100644
index 000000000000..e1d50c2bb0e0
--- /dev/null
+++ b/media-plugins/vdr-osdteletext/files/digest-vdr-osdteletext-0.5.1-r1
@@ -0,0 +1,3 @@
+MD5 52c219e38a089504071237209ad114cd vdr-osdteletext-0.5.1.tgz 58631
+RMD160 b53bee592844f4527917fe28a322e3561de19092 vdr-osdteletext-0.5.1.tgz 58631
+SHA256 e3cb0b95d351d0fc63ba3e1ca82f776e44f1a1945ffad574b54a55e0169fa969 vdr-osdteletext-0.5.1.tgz 58631
diff --git a/media-plugins/vdr-osdteletext/files/vdr-osdteletext-0.5.1-vdr-1.5.patch b/media-plugins/vdr-osdteletext/files/vdr-osdteletext-0.5.1-vdr-1.5.patch
new file mode 100644
index 000000000000..eef0fe66677c
--- /dev/null
+++ b/media-plugins/vdr-osdteletext/files/vdr-osdteletext-0.5.1-vdr-1.5.patch
@@ -0,0 +1,55 @@
+diff -aur osdteletext-0.5.1/Makefile osdteletext/Makefile
+--- osdteletext-0.5.1/Makefile 2005-08-08 18:29:22.000000000 +0200
++++ osdteletext/Makefile 2006-04-23 17:54:49.000000000 +0200
+@@ -20,7 +20,6 @@
+
+ ### The directory environment:
+
+-DVBDIR = ../../../../DVB
+ VDRDIR = ../../..
+ LIBDIR = ../../lib
+ TMPDIR = /tmp
+@@ -32,6 +31,10 @@
+ ### The version number of VDR (taken from VDR's "config.h"):
+
+ VDRVERSION = $(shell grep 'define VDRVERSION ' $(VDRDIR)/config.h | awk '{ print $$3 }' | sed -e 's/"//g')
++APIVERSION = $(shell grep 'define APIVERSION ' $(VDRDIR)/config.h | awk '{ print $$3 }' | sed -e 's/"//g')
++ifeq ($(strip $(APIVERSION)),)
++ APIVERSION = $(VDRVERSION)
++endif
+
+ ### The name of the distribution archive:
+
+@@ -40,7 +43,7 @@
+
+ ### Includes and Defines (add further entries here):
+
+-INCLUDES += -I$(VDRDIR)/include -I$(DVBDIR)/include
++INCLUDES += -I$(VDRDIR)/include
+
+ DEFINES += -DPLUGIN_NAME_I18N='"$(PLUGIN)"' -D_GNU_SOURCE
+
+@@ -72,7 +75,7 @@
+
+ libvdr-$(PLUGIN).so: $(OBJS)
+ $(CXX) $(CXXFLAGS) -shared $(OBJS) -o $@
+- @cp $@ $(LIBDIR)/$@.$(VDRVERSION)
++ @cp $@ $(LIBDIR)/$@.$(APIVERSION)
+
+ dist: clean
+ @-rm -rf $(TMPDIR)/$(ARCHIVE)
+Nur in osdteletext: .svn.
+diff -aur osdteletext-0.5.1/txtrecv.c osdteletext/txtrecv.c
+--- osdteletext-0.5.1/txtrecv.c 2005-08-12 13:20:09.000000000 +0200
++++ osdteletext/txtrecv.c 2007-01-14 00:14:15.667936696 +0100
+@@ -692,7 +692,9 @@
+ */
+
+ cTxtReceiver::cTxtReceiver(int TPid, tChannelID chan)
+-#if VDRVERSNUM >= 10319
++#if VDRVERSNUM >= 10500
++ : cReceiver(chan, -1, TPid),
++#elif VDRVERSNUM >= 10319
+ : cReceiver(0, -1, TPid),
+ #else
+ : cReceiver(0, -1, 1, TPid),
diff --git a/media-plugins/vdr-osdteletext/vdr-osdteletext-0.5.1-r1.ebuild b/media-plugins/vdr-osdteletext/vdr-osdteletext-0.5.1-r1.ebuild
new file mode 100644
index 000000000000..3f69716ccb13
--- /dev/null
+++ b/media-plugins/vdr-osdteletext/vdr-osdteletext-0.5.1-r1.ebuild
@@ -0,0 +1,29 @@
+# Copyright 1999-2007 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/media-plugins/vdr-osdteletext/vdr-osdteletext-0.5.1-r1.ebuild,v 1.1 2007/04/02 10:48:19 zzam Exp ${VDRPLUGIN}/vdr-${VDRPLUGIN}-0.3.1.ebuild,v 1.1 2003/05/13 09:39:19 fow0ryl Exp $
+
+inherit vdr-plugin
+
+DESCRIPTION="Video Disk Recorder OSD-Teletext Plugin"
+HOMEPAGE="http://www.wiesweg-online.de/linux/linux.html"
+SRC_URI="http://www.wiesweg-online.de/linux/vdr/${P}.tgz
+ mirror://vdrfiles/${PN}/${P}.tgz"
+
+SLOT="0"
+LICENSE="GPL-2"
+KEYWORDS="~amd64 ~x86"
+IUSE=""
+
+DEPEND=">=media-video/vdr-1.2.5"
+
+PATCHES="${FILESDIR}/i18n_german_lang.diff
+ ${FILESDIR}/${P}-vdr-1.5.patch"
+
+src_install() {
+ vdr-plugin_src_install
+
+ # create the teletext directory
+ diropts -m755 -ovdr -gvdr
+ keepdir /var/cache/${VDRPLUGIN}
+
+}